Town of Shrewsbury, MA $45,690,000 General Obligation Bonds Net 1.418%

The Board of Selectmen have announced that the Town received competitive bids from bond underwriters on Tuesday, January 12, 2021, for a $45,690,000 20-year bond issue. Morgan Stanley & Co, LLC was the winning bidder on the Bonds with an average interest rate of 1.418%.  The Town received a total of 10 bids on the Bonds. Bond proceeds will be used to finance costs related to the Police Station construction and SELCO's Fiber to the Home project.  With this interest rate, taxpayers will pay $2,089,639 less than presented at Town Meeting on September 29, 2020. 

Prior to the sale S&P Global Ratings, a municipal bond credit rating agency, assigned a rating of ‘AAA’ to the Bonds, the highest rating attainable. The rating agency cited the Town’s very strong economy, strong management with good financial policies and practices, strong budgetary performance and flexibility, very strong liquidity, strong debt and contingent liability profile, and strong institutional framework as positive credit factors. 

Ms. Beth Casavant, Chair of the Board of Selectmen states, "To maintain our AAA bond rating given the challenges associated with the COVID-19 pandemic is a testament to the strength of our financial management policies and collaborative working relationship across Town departments. This rating translates into millions of dollars in savings for the taxpayers as borrowing occurs for the police station building project. The Board of Selectmen is grateful for the work of Mr. Mizikar and Town staff for their continued efforts on behalf of the community "

The bids for the Bonds were accepted at the offices of the Town’s Financial Advisor, Hilltop Securities Inc., at 54 Canal Street in Boston, Massachusetts.
